A man name Rossy who is a full-time Ailrbus A320 pilot went on the mission fly across the english channel his self-made contraption. The contraption was hitched a on airplane ride and take to about 8000 feet high over Calis, France. Then the composite wing rocket airplane was released, the engines were ignited while still in the plane and Rossy wore a flame-resistant suit to protect his back against the flames of the engine blast. He rocketed at 120 MPH, for about 22 miles and did it in 13 minutes thanks to the help of the four kerosene-powered jet turbines affixed to the composite wing. The rocket kit is basically an jet-assisted rocket pack glider with an 8-foot wingspan.
